Xiaowei W.
About Xiaowei W.
Xiaowei W. is a Software Engineer specializing in backend development with the Go programming language. Currently employed at Northvolt in Stockholm, Sweden, he focuses on serverless architectures, microservices, and cloud solutions using AWS.
Work at Northvolt
Xiaowei W. has been employed as a Software Engineer at Northvolt since 2021. Located in Stockholm, Stockholm County, Sweden, Xiaowei focuses on backend development, contributing to various projects that align with Northvolt's mission in sustainable energy solutions. The role involves utilizing modern technologies and methodologies to enhance software performance and reliability.
Backend Development Expertise
Xiaowei specializes in backend development, primarily using the Go programming language. This expertise allows for the creation of efficient and scalable applications. Xiaowei's work includes designing and implementing RESTful APIs and GraphQL interfaces, which facilitate seamless communication between different software components.
Cloud Solutions and Serverless Architectures
In the current role, Xiaowei employs AWS for cloud-based solutions, leveraging its capabilities to build robust applications. The focus on serverless architectures and microservices enables the development of flexible and maintainable systems, which are essential for modern software development.
Development Methodologies
Xiaowei utilizes Test-Driven Development (TDD) methodologies in software projects. This approach emphasizes writing tests before code, ensuring that software is reliable and meets specified requirements. Additionally, involvement in projects that use OpenAPI specifications demonstrates a commitment to standardizing API design and documentation.